1. The Shift to LiFePO4 Batteries

The industry is rapidly moving away from lead-acid and traditional ternary lithium batteries toward Lithium Iron Phosphate (LiFePO4). These batteries offer over 2000 charge cycles and superior thermal stability, making them ideal for high-temperature environments in the Middle East and Southeast Asia.

2. Bifacial Solar Panel Technology

Modern solar smart lights are beginning to incorporate bifacial panels that can harvest light from both sides, increasing energy yield by up to 15% in snowy or sandy environments through Albedo effects.

Q2: Can the solar floodlights work during consecutive rainy days?

A: Yes. Our "Smart Control" systems feature adaptive power management. When the battery charge is low, the system automatically adjusts the brightness to ensure the light provides essential illumination throughout the night, extending the discharge time for 3-5 rainy days.
